The PI.EXCHANGE AI & Analytics Engine (the Engine) is a Data Science and Machine Learning (ML) platform that empowers everyone, even novice users, to affordably build high-performance ML applications in minutes or hours, not weeks or months.
The easy-to-use connected toolchain provides everything you will need to go from raw data to predictions and insights within a single pipeline. Manual and repetitive machine learning tasks are automated, and the Engine's intelligent features help guide the user end-to-end. So, whether you are building a small pilot project with no dedicated data science resources, or are deploying large-scale enterprise ML systems, you can equip your existing team with the right tool to build meaningful solutions, fast. The Engine gives users the flexibility to customize their ML pipeline from scratch for classification, regression, time-series, or clustering problems or to select an ML solution template to develop their ML application. While both ML development options are guided and require no-coding experience, the latter requires only articulation of business requirements and problem context via a few key steps - everything else is taken care of.
Notable AI solutions include: Customer Churn Prediction Leveraging your manufacturing data to build predictive maintenance strategies Predict online fraudulent transactions and reduce false positives and; Optimize logistics decision-making

I selected this library as I normally use much higher-level tools to develop games such as p5.js, or GDevelop. Both these tools are amazing in their own right; however, I want to learn how these processes operate on a much lower level. These tools take care of a lot of issues for you ranging from asset to memory management. Raylib is still cross-platform but does not handle these tasks for the programmer which I... - Source: dev.to / almost 2 years ago
